    Nigeria signals more strikes likely in ‘joint’ US operations

    TARGETS UNCLEAR

    The Division of Protection’s US Africa Command, utilizing an acronym for the Islamic State group, stated “a number of ISIS (Islamic State of Iraq and Syria) terrorists” have been killed in an assault within the northwestern state of Sokoto.

    US defence officers later posted video of what gave the impression to be the nighttime launch of a missile from the deck of a battleship flying the US flag.

    Which of Nigeria’s myriad armed teams have been focused stays unclear.

    Nigeria’s jihadist teams are principally concentrated within the northeast of the nation, however have made inroads into the northwest.

    Researchers have lately linked some members from an armed group often known as Lakurawa – the principle jihadist group situated in Sokoto State – to Islamic State Sahel Province (ISSP), which is usually energetic in neighbouring Niger and Mali.

    Different analysts have disputed these hyperlinks, although analysis on Lakurawa is difficult because the time period has been used to explain numerous armed fighters within the northwest.

    These described as Lakurawa additionally reportedly have hyperlinks to Al-Qaeda affiliated group for the Help of Islam and Muslims, a rival group to ISSP.

    Whereas Abuja has welcomed the strikes, “I believe Trump wouldn’t have accepted a ‘No’ from Nigeria”, stated Malik Samuel, an Abuja-based researcher for Good Governance Africa, a non-governmental organisation.

    Amid the diplomatic strain, Nigerian authorities are eager to be seen as cooperating with the US, Samuel advised AFP, although “each the perpetrators and the victims within the northwest are overwhelmingly Muslim”.

    Tuggar stated that Nigerian President Bola Tinubu “gave the go-ahead” for the strikes.

    The international minister added: “It should be made clear that it’s a joint operation, and it isn’t focusing on any faith nor merely within the identify of 1 faith or the opposite.”
